DXGKDDI_MONITORSOURCEMODESET_ACQUIREFIRSTMODEINFO回调函数 (d3dkmddi.h)

pfnAcquireFirstModeInfo 函数返回指定监视器源模式集中第一个模式的描述符。

语法

DXGKDDI_MONITORSOURCEMODESET_ACQUIREFIRSTMODEINFO DxgkddiMonitorsourcemodesetAcquirefirstmodeinfo;

NTSTATUS DxgkddiMonitorsourcemodesetAcquirefirstmodeinfo(
  [in]  IN_CONST_D3DKMDT_HMONITORSOURCEMODESET hMonitorSourceModeSet,
  [out] DEREF_OUT_CONST_PPD3DKMDT_MONITOR_SOURCE_MODE ppFirstMonitorSourceModeInfo
)
{...}

参数

[in] hMonitorSourceModeSet

监视器源模式集对象的句柄。 显示微型端口驱动程序以前通过调用 Monitor 接口pfnAcquireMonitorSourceModeSet 函数来获取此句柄。

[out] ppFirstMonitorSourceModeInfo

指向变量的指针,该变量接收指向 D3DKMDT_MONITOR_SOURCE_MODE 结构的指针。 结构包含有关监视器源模式的各种信息,包括其 ID 和视频信号特征。

返回值

pfnAcquireFirstModeInfo 函数返回以下值之一:

返回代码 说明
STATUS_SUCCESS 函数成功。
STATUS_GRAPHICS_INVALID_MONITOR_SOURCEMODESET hMonitorSourceModeSet 中提供的句柄无效。

注解

使用 完 D3DKMDT_MONITOR_SOURCE_MODE 结构后,必须通过调用 pfnReleaseModeInfo 释放结构。

可以通过调用 pfnAcquireFirstModeInfo,然后对 pfnAcquireNextModeInfo 进行一系列调用来枚举属于 VidPN 监视器源模式集对象的所有模式。

D3DKMDT_HMONITORSOURCEMODESET数据类型在 D3dkmdt.h 中定义。

要求

要求
最低受支持的客户端 Windows Vista
目标平台 桌面
标头 d3dkmddi.h (包括 D3dkmddi.h)
IRQL PASSIVE_LEVEL

另请参阅

D3DKMDT_MONITOR_SOURCE_MODE

pfnAcquireNextModeInfo

pfnReleaseModeInfo